Vorschrift
157 g of 4-nitrochlorobenzene, 200 g of dimethylsulfoxide, 62.7 g of potassium fluoride, and 2.49 g of (N,N-dimethylimidazolidino)tetramethyl-guanidinium chloride were placed in a 1 liter four-neck flask equipped with thermometer, anchor stirrer, and reflux condenser with bubble counter. The mixture was heated with stirring to 170° C. and kept at this temperature for 5 hours. The reaction mixture was then cooled to room temperature, water was added at a volumetric ratio of 1:1, the phases that formed were separated, and, from the organic phase, by fractional distillation at reduced pressure, 4-nitrofluorobenzene was obtained in a yield of 96% of theory.
